The Comeback Kid is a 1980 American made-for-television sports romantic comedy film starring John Ritter, Susan Dey and Doug McKeon which was broadcast on ABC on April 11, 1980.
Plot
Bubba Newman, a baseball player from the minor league decides to quit baseball and do something else with his life because he feels "down and out". Bubba gets a renewed look at life when he becomes a coach for a group of kids who are underprivileged and finds romance.
